Why did Derrick and Lindsey Drake decide to plant a church in Magnolia, Texas? Here at The Collective Church, that story unfolds. The Collective Church isn’t just a building. It’s a testament to a vision. A vision born from Derrick and Lindsey Drake’s deep desire to guide generations towards faith. The Collective Church officially launched on January 26th, 2020. But its roots lie deeper, in the Drakes’ journey. Derrick, originally from Jacksonville, Florida, moved to Houston in 2007. Lindsey, a native Texan, joined him in marriage in 2009. Derrick had already been working in full-time ministry, focusing on youth. But a divine nudge redirected them. While seeking guidance, a message from an old mentor echoed their own prayers. “You two are starting a church.” It was the confirmation they needed. The Drakes’ yes led them to the Houston Church Planting Network. From 2017 to 2019, Derrick honed his skills under the mentorship of Houston’s leading pastors. This training, coupled with their passion for the next generation, shaped The Collective Church into what it is today. The Collective Church isn’t just about Sunday service. It’s about everyday faith, woven into the lives of the community, especially with Magnolia’s growing millennial and GenZ population. It’s a collective effort, a community striving to live on mission. The Collective Church, a place where generations come together, guided by the Drakes and their team, to find and follow Jesus in their everyday lives.
